Win Cam ~ David Gauthier & Joe LaRocca
80 Skillings Road Winchester, MA 01890 781-721-2050 wincam@wincam.org wincam.org HOURS OF OPERATION: Mon - Fri 1:00 pm - 9:00 pm Sat 10:00 am - 1:00 pm Sun Closed
For over ten years, WinCAM has been Winchester's source for local access television programming and media education. Our mission is to promote and facilitate free speech while providing access to established and emerging media. Reaching your television via Comcast Channels 8 & 9, and Verizon Channels 36 & 37, WinCAM is a non-profit membership organization providing the community with television production training workshops and professional production facilities.We employ a small staff that depends greatly on trained volunteer members to produce content for our channels. Although our staff does produce certain events, like School Committee Meetings, Selectmen's Meetings,
local elections and Town Meetings, our main function is to provide the means for Winchester residents to produce their own shows. Membership Prices: Students & Seniors: $10 Individuals: $25 Families: $45 Organizations: $100
Once you sign up for membership and complete a short orientation, there are no other fees to pay. All the training, use of the equipment and facilities, airtime and the support of our professional staff is included with your membership, and there are no age limits. Contact us and get started today.
Winchester Art & Frame ~ David H. Smith, CPF
755 Main Street Winchester, MA 01890 781-721-1447
www.winchesterartandframe.com winart755@gmail.com HOURS OF OPERATION: Mon - Frid 9:00 - 6:00 Sat 9:00 - 4:00
Winchester Art & Frame carries fine and decorative art, provides framing services with emphasis on design and conservation, and provides restoration services. We also carry several lines of photo frames, easels, and gifts such as hand-blown glass, pottery, albums, leaded glass boxes, hand-turned wood pieces and semiprecious jewelry. The gallery currently contains the art of more than sixty artists, including original watercolors, oils and photography, giclees, hand colored etchings, serigraphs, lithographs, needlework, mixed media
and antique art and maps. Ancillary services are provided such as deacidification, dry mounting, blocking and stretch mounting, shrink wrapping and installation.
There are over 3,000 frame samples from which to select. We make the framing experience painless by working with you through the design and selection process of mats, glazing and appropriate materials and processes, with emphasis on the protection and long-term conservation of the art.
